U of Colorado Engineering Technologies Bachelor’s Program Diversity

Among recent graduates, 49% of engineering technologies bachelor’s degrees went to men and 51% went to women.

U of Colorado gender breakdown of Engineering Technologies Bachelor's degree grads

The majority of engineering technologies bachelor’s degree graduates at U of Colorado are White. Roughly 54% of graduates fell into this category.

The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from University of Colorado Boulder with a bachelor’s in engineering technologies.

Ethnic diversity of Engineering Technologies majors at University of Colorado Boulder
Ethnic Background Number of Students
Asian 15
Black or African American 0
Hispanic or Latino 5
White 34
Non-Resident Aliens 0
Other Races 9
